The Echo Sport Podcast crew break down the opening weekend of Cork GAA championship action where upsets for Carrigaline and Newcestown grabbed the headlines as last year's finalists St Finbarr's and Nemo were beaten.Carrigaline were mauled by the Barrs in the opening last season and despite trailing early in the second half last Friday night, they pushed on to a win that gives them a great chance of progressing to the knockout stages. Cork footballer Brian O'Driscoll contributed heavily but Éanna Desmond was the star turn to the tune of 0-9 from play.Newcestown, beaten after extra time by Nemo in last year's semi-final, made no mistake this time. Seamus O'Sullivan nabbed 0-7 while their best-known players Luke Meade and David Buckley were to the fore as always.There's still plenty of time for the city sides to get back on track and the other member of the Premier Senior 'big three', Castlehaven, got the job done against a youthful Ballincollig despite conceding three goals.Douglas were emphatic winners over Mallow, Séan Coakley highlighting his Cork potential, and Clon, dark horses in recent years, beat newcomers Knocknagree.Cill na Martra took down Carbery Rangers in the collision between the two favourites at Senior A, while Éire Óg and Kanturk also underlined their title credentials. The performance of the weekend came from Fermoy, who were six points down with five minutes left against Naomh Abán and kicked seven without reply to win. Dohenys also roared from 11 down to draw with Aghabullogue while Newmarket put up an impressive tally in defeating Skibb.Can the hurling action across the August Bank Holiday weekend match the entertainment? With Midleton against the Barrs and Glen taking on Blackrock, there are some crackers on the horizon.We also salute Mayo, All-Ireland champions for the first time in 75 years who ended their final curse, despite going 1-5 to 0-1 down after 16 minutes. Welcome back to another edition of Ar An Lá Seo on the 18th of September, with me Lauren Ní Loingsigh 1970: A 22 year old Dublin electrician lay trapped for 2 hours under a lift which collapsed on him. 1992: Taoiseach Albert Reynolds last night forecast that up to 5,000 jobs would be created through investment decisions soon to be announced by American Companies. 1987: 2 more Clare creamaries Darragh and Kilnamona have been closed down by Golden Vale. 1992: Taoiseach Albert Renolds officialy opened the Shannon Aerospace project. That was The Shamen with Ebeneezer Goode – the biggest song on this day in 1992 Onto music news on this day In 1993 Meat Loaf went to No.1 on the UK album chart for the first of five times with Bat Out Of Hell II. 2009 Leonard Cohen collapsed on stage during a concert in Valencia in Spain and was taken to hospital. And finally celebrity birthdays on this day – Jada Pinkett Smith was born in America in 1971 and actor James Marsden was born in America on this day in 1973 and this is some of the stuff he has done. Send us a textWriter, David Halpin is a mine of information on Irish folklore, fairylore and mythology in general and ideas around consciousness. David looks at the Irish stories and fairy folklore in a refreshing way, through the lens of writers such as Jacques Vallée and John Keel. His Circle Stories on Facebook is an excellent resource and there's a shortened version on Instagram.https://www.facebook.com/CircleStoriesDavidHalpinhttps://www.instagram.com/circle__stories/We discuss some of the stories on Duchas.ie Schools Collection (see link below) which relate to children. Some of these involve children being taken to fairyland NB. these are not changeling stories which are a separate type of fairy lore.
